Introduction to Data-Driven Cartographic Storytelling

Data-driven cartographic storytelling is the art of presenting complex data in a way that is not only visually appealing but also easy to understand. This approach leverages the power of maps and infographics to tell a story, making it easier for stakeholders to grasp the significance of the data. Practical Applications in Business

# Enhancing Marketing Strategies

One of the most direct applications of data-driven cartographic storytelling is in the realm of marketing. For instance, a retail chain might use this approach to analyze customer traffic patterns and predict future store locations. By mapping out customer movements and preferences, they can optimize store layouts and stock levels, leading to increased sales and customer satisfaction. In a case study involving a major retail brand, participants learned to create heat maps that highlighted high-traffic areas within stores, which helped them design more efficient store layouts and product placements.

# Improving Operational Efficiency

Operational efficiency is another key area where data-driven cartography can make a significant impact. A logistics company, for example, could use this technique to optimize delivery routes and reduce fuel costs. By analyzing delivery routes and traffic patterns, the company was able to identify the most efficient paths, resulting in a 15% reduction in fuel consumption and a 10% improvement in delivery times. This case study demonstrated how data-driven cartography can lead to tangible cost savings and improved service levels.
